From Confusion to Confidence: A Parent’s Voice

“Before the Raise for Autism campaign, we did not understand what autism really is. Many parents were confused, afraid, and isolated. Through Vijana Na Taifa’s awareness sessions, we learned that autism is not a curse — it is a condition that needs understanding, support, and proper care.

The campaign gave us hope, knowledge, and a sense of community. We now speak openly, seek help earlier, and advocate for our children with confidence. This work is changing lives, one family at a time.”*

Parent & Community Member, Nairobi
